About the role
The Asset Manager leads and manages a range of enterprise-wide facilities operation functions in support of the Facilities and Projects Business Unit. The role works under broad guidelines to initiate, plan, implement, manage and deliver significant Facilities and Asset services in accordance with TAFE SA strategic goals and government policy. The Asset Manager is responsible to oversee high level and professional management of TAFE SA facilities and asset service arrangements, delivered internally and contracted externally. The role encompasses the management and leadership of a team of staff.

Key Selection Criteria

  • Demonstrated capacity to identify and analyse tactical and operational issues and think laterally to develop sound approaches to meet the Facilities operational needs of the business.
  • Strong management qualities and demonstrated ability to develop others to work as a team to achieve objectives and take a shared responsibility for achieving results.
  • Demonstrated experience in the provision of effective asset management services in a complex organisation that requires negotiating, developing and monitoring performance and/or service level agreements, contracts or tenders with external service providers, including the AGFMA.
  • High level oral, written and interpersonal skills that foster sound working relationships with staff and a range of stakeholders in a climate of continuing change.
  • Demonstrated experience in the provision of effective asset management decisions encompassing compliance, industry standards, life cycle modelling with an understanding of Workplace Health and Safety and Environmental Sustainability impacts.
  • Demonstrated ability to work under broad guidelines, deal with competing demands, manage multiple projects and effectively manage the needs of multiple stakeholders in a complex environment.
  • Extensive experience in the application and understanding of Strategic Asset Management Framework principals including related tools, policies, procedures, plans, strategies and information systems aligning to ISO55001.
  • If you hold qualifications in Engineering or a Trade, Asset Management, or high-level Project Management this would be considered highly desirable.
